#431972 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#431972 is composed of 26.3% red, 9.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.2%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 268.3 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 27.3%. #431972 color hex could be obtained by blending #8632e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#431972 color description : Very dark violet.

#431972 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#431972 has RGB values of R:67, G:25,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4397426.

Shades and Tints of #431972

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f6f0f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#431972

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454447 is the less saturated color, while #420487 is the most saturated one.
